    <title>Compliance relief for delayed company filings: reduced fee regularisation, dormancy or strike off with conditional immunity.</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/highlights?id=97550</link>
    <description>Companies Compliance Facilitation Scheme, 2026 creates a limited one time mechanism to condone delayed filings of annual returns and financial statements by permitting companies to regularise pending relevant e forms during the scheme period (15 April 2026-15 July 2026). The Scheme permits three options: complete pending filings on payment of a reduced additional fee, seek dormant company status on payment of half the normal fee, or apply for striking off on payment of a reduced filing fee. Limited immunity from penalty is provided where filings occur before or within thirty days of adjudication notice; exclusions and post scheme enforcement by Registrars apply.</description>
